K & N Filtercharger
 
2 Attachment(s)
I just finished installing a K & N Filtercharger on my 99 Cop Tahoe. I have driven the Tahoe enough to know how it accelerates and feels. At idle I have a touch of a rumble now and cruising it sounds the same. When you walk on it oh boy, that filter makes seat of the pants difference and sounds super as it sucks all that nice cool fresh air. They guarantee 10 to 15 horsepower with these things and I believe it. We will see if my gas mileage improves.

If you haven't had one before, I have two helpful points to a happy K&N...

1, Don't over clean it. It will get gunky looking, but is far from plugging up.

2, Don't over oil it. Remember how it looked when you opened it. Spray it lightly, let it sit, then wipe off all the excess.
